It's not censoring #flotilla search - it IS censoring trending topics. A highly selective, possibly first case, of word censoring. It's also censoring #gaza, #israel along with #flotilla.
This sort of selection is apparently based on an operator action/directives rather than automated one (#israil - Turkish for #isreal is not censored).
Now, this is turning highly political and opinionated as Twitter hasn't previously censored #iran or other politically charged words.
